ASX ANNOUNCEMENT ASX: PXA

19 August 2022

Release of shares from voluntary escrow

In accordance with ASX Listing Rule 3.10A, PEXA Group Limited (‘Company’ or ‘PEXA Group’) advises as follows:

  1. 3,269,494 fully paid ordinary shares will be released from voluntary escrow on 26 August 2022. As disclosed in the Replacement Prospectus dated 21 June 2021, shares held by Escrowed Management would be subject to voluntary escrow arrangements until the release of the Company’s financial results for the financial year ended 30 June 2022 (Management Escrowed Shares). As announced to ASX, the financial results for FY22 will be released to ASX on 26 August 2022.

  2. 64,709 fully paid ordinary shares will be released from voluntary escrow on 29 August 2022. As disclosed in the Replacement Prospectus dated 21 June 2021, shares issued pursuant to the Employee and Director offer would be released upon the opening of the trading window following the release of the Company’s results for the financial year ended 30 June 2022. The trading window will open on 29 August 2022.

  3. 1,475 shares have been released from voluntary escrow under the terms of the Employee Gift Offer and 291 shares have been released from voluntary escrow under the terms of the Employee and Director Offer.

About PEXA Group Limited

PEXA operates Australia’s leading online property exchange network. It assists members – such as lawyers, conveyancers and financial institutions – lodge documents with Land Registries and complete financial settlements electronically. PEXA is committed to supporting the property industry as it transitions towards a 100 per cent digital conveyancing process that is fast, safe and efficient. PEXA is actively exploring domestic and international growth opportunities that leverage its experience, expertise and proprietary technology.
